An Austintown woman is charged after police and the state Bureau of Criminal Investigation found sexually explicit images of her with her children and a dog.

The images were found after her boyfriend was arrested last month in Niles in a child pornography case.

Connie Ramirez, 43, of Meridian Road was arrested on Aug. 21 and arraigned in Austintown court on charges of rape, gross sexual imposition, pandering obscenity with a minor and possession of criminal tools.

BCI found images and videos on a cell phone of Ramirez with her 9-year-old and 8-year-old daughters and a dog after searching her boyfriend William Brock’s Niles home in July. Brock was arrested on July 19 and faces multiple charges for child pornography, including pandering obscenity involving a minor, in Trumbull County.

Neighbors of Brock said he liked to dress up as Santa Claus. Brock is being detained in the Trumbull County jail

Ramirez confessed to police that she was the woman in the pictures and videos. During the interview with police, Ramirez admitted to rubbing ointment on her child for sexual stimulation, according to an investigative report. She also admitted to sending the explicit content to her boyfriend. Several items were seized from her home and are being reviewed for additional evidence.

Ramirez is being detained on $500,000 bond at the Mahoning County jail.

Austintown police, Niles police and the Federal Bureau of Investigation assisted in the investigations.
